Varieties Of Ceramic Tile

Ceramic tiles have become an essential choice for countless UK homes, celebrated for their exceptional durability and striking aesthetic appeal. With a vast array of options available, homeowners can choose from porcelain and glazed tiles. Porcelain tiles, crafted from a finer type of clay and fired at higher temperatures, significantly boost their resistance to moisture and stains, making them particularly suitable for the often damp UK climate. On the other hand, glazed tiles boast a glass-like surface that enhances their visual appeal while facilitating easy cleaning. With an extensive variety of colours and designs at their disposal, homeowners can effortlessly discover tiles that reflect their individual tastes and interior design aspirations, adding a personalised touch to every room.

Key Considerations for a Successful Ceramic Tile Installation

Installing Ceramic Tiles

The installation of ceramic tiles in UK residences requires a range of critical considerations that necessitate thorough preparation. A well-prepared subfloor is essential for ensuring stability and durability; any imperfections could lead to cracks or movement in the tiles over time. Generally, a concrete or cement backer board is recommended as a solid foundation, particularly in moisture-prone areas like bathrooms and kitchens.

The selection of adhesive is equally crucial. Numerous types of adhesives are specifically designed for ceramic tiles, and choosing the right one is vital for ensuring the longevity of the installation. For example, a flexible adhesive is often preferred in environments where temperature variations are common, as it can accommodate movement without compromising the structural integrity of the tiles.

Optimising Steam Cleaner Settings for Maximum Effectiveness

Steam Cleaning A Ceramic Tile floor

The settings of steam cleaners—particularly temperature and pressure—are crucial for their effectiveness on ceramic tiles. A steam cleaner that operates at elevated temperatures (approximately 120°C to 150°C) is typically ideal for tackling tough stains and disinfecting surfaces. However, it is imperative to ensure that the pressure settings are suitable for ceramic tiles, as excessive pressure can potentially damage the tiles themselves.

Selecting the appropriate settings can significantly enhance the cleaning experience while also safeguarding the integrity of the tiles. For instance, using a lower pressure setting can be advantageous for older or more delicate tiles, reducing the risk of cracking or chipping. Grasping these dynamics allows homeowners to optimise the capabilities of their steam cleaners for efficient cleaning without compromising tile quality.

Key Maintenance Practices for Extending the Life of Your Steam Cleaner

Proper upkeep of a steam cleaner is vital for its longevity and optimal performance, especially when frequently used on ceramic tiles. Regularly inspecting the water reservoir for signs of limescale build-up can help prevent operational issues and extend the machine’s lifespan. Choosing distilled water instead of tap water can mitigate this issue, as it reduces the accumulation of mineral deposits within the device.

Cleaning the brushes and attachments after each use can also contribute to the steam cleaner’s longevity and ensure optimal performance. This proactive maintenance approach not only boosts efficiency but also safeguards the ceramic tiles from potential damage caused by dirt or debris that may become trapped in worn-out attachments, thereby preserving their aesthetic appeal.

Understanding the Risks Associated with Ceramic Tile Maintenance

Identifying Risks Linked to Grout Damage

While steam cleaning can provide benefits for ceramic tiles, it also poses significant risks to grout, the porous material that binds the tiles together. The high temperature and pressure of steam can lead to grout deterioration, causing it to crack or crumble over time. This risk is especially heightened if the grout has not been properly sealed or maintained.

Moreover, damaged grout can lead to various complications, including water infiltration, which can threaten the structural integrity of the tiles themselves. Homeowners should exercise caution when employing steam cleaning techniques and follow up with regular inspections of grout lines to detect any early signs of damage, thereby prolonging the life of both the grout and the tiles.

How to Prevent Tile Cracking During Cleaning

Ceramic tiles, while generally robust, are not immune to damage from steam cleaning. The phenomenon known as thermal shock can occur when there is a rapid temperature change, causing the tiles to expand and contract. If the steam cleaner’s settings are excessively high or if the tiles are already compromised from prior wear, this can lead to cracking or shattering.

To minimise this risk, homeowners should avoid using steam cleaners on older or unsealed tiles, as well as those that already exhibit cracks. Gradually introducing steam cleaning at lower temperatures can help acclimatise the tiles to the heat, thereby reducing the likelihood of thermal shock. Awareness of these risks is crucial for maintaining the structural integrity of ceramic tile flooring.

Understanding Sealant Degradation Risks

Many ceramic tiles in UK homes are treated with sealants designed to protect their surfaces from stains and moisture. However, steam cleaning can compromise these sealants, leading to their degradation over time. The intense heat generated can break down the polymers within the sealant, resulting in a reduced lifespan of the protective layer.

Homeowners should remain vigilant regarding the condition of their sealants if they opt for steam cleaning. Regularly inspecting tile surfaces for signs of wear and reapplying sealants as necessary can help maintain the protective barrier, ensuring the longevity and functionality of the ceramic tiles while keeping them visually appealing.

Financial Considerations for UK Residents Regarding Tile Cleaning

Initial Costs of Steam Cleaning Equipment

When contemplating the purchase of a steam cleaner, UK residents should carefully evaluate the initial investment against the benefits it provides. Prices for steam cleaners can vary significantly, with basic models starting at around £30 and more advanced units surpassing £200. This initial expense should be compared with traditional cleaning tools, which may have lower upfront prices but typically require ongoing purchases of cleaning supplies to maintain effectiveness.

While steam cleaners may entail a higher initial cost, the long-term savings on cleaning products and time can considerably offset this investment. Users should consider their cleaning frequency and specific needs when selecting the most suitable option for their requirements, ensuring they make a well-informed decision.

Frequently Asked Questions About Ceramic Tile Cleaning

Can I safely use a steam cleaner on all types of ceramic tiles?

Not all ceramic tiles are suitable for steam cleaning. It is advisable to consult the manufacturer for specific guidelines regarding the tile type and surface finish before proceeding with steam cleaning.

What are the primary risks associated with steam cleaning ceramic tiles?

The main risks include grout damage, tile cracking due to thermal shock, and potential degradation of sealants, which can undermine the tile’s protective layer.

How often should I steam clean my ceramic tiles?

The frequency of steam cleaning depends on usage. Generally, high-traffic areas may require cleaning every few months, while less frequently used areas can be cleaned less often.

What alternative methods can I use to clean ceramic tiles?

Effective alternatives include traditional methods, such as using a mild detergent, and employing chemical cleaners specifically formulated for professional use.

Are there environmentally friendly cleaning options available for ceramic tiles?

Yes, natural solutions such as vinegar and baking soda can clean effectively without the use of harsh chemicals, making them eco-friendly alternatives.

How can I prevent grout damage while cleaning tiles?

Regularly sealing grout lines and using gentle cleaning methods can help prevent damage to the grout. Avoid using high-pressure steam cleaning, as it can lead to crumbling or cracking.

Can steam cleaning effectively eliminate germs on ceramic tiles?

Yes, the high temperatures associated with steam cleaning can effectively eliminate germs, making it a hygienic choice for cleaning tiles.

What steps should I take if my tiles crack after steam cleaning?

If your tiles crack after a steam clean, have a professional assess the issue. Ensure you review the warranty, as it may cover repair costs.

What maintenance practices can I adopt for optimal steam cleaner performance?

Regularly clean the water reservoir, replace attachments as needed, and utilise distilled water to reduce limescale build-up. Following the manufacturer’s maintenance guidelines is essential for optimal performance.

Is investing in a steam cleaner a worthwhile choice for my home?

Investing in a steam cleaner can be beneficial if you regularly clean ceramic tiles, as it provides effective cleaning and potentially saves time. However, consider your cleaning habits and specific requirements before making a decision.
